Output d7ec92b0b88bf075da7cd54663eb8a0d58582cb153a5e0c404606cd8eb264afc:16

value
595582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ec317cffa3128b05669f8f4cfebf9d415959d90a OP_EQUAL
address
3PDtgKbUfWPR1WdPPuzZie4P58PZf9L9er
transaction
d7ec92b0b88bf075da7cd54663eb8a0d58582cb153a5e0c404606cd8eb264afc
spent
true